2014 Food Network South Beach Wine & Food Festival Presented by FOOD & WINE Raises More Than $2 Million for Florida International University's Chaplin School of Hospital

The 13th annual Food Network South Beach Wine & Food Festival presented by FOOD & WINE, which took place February 20-23, 2014, featured more than 250 of the industry's leading winemakers, spirits producers, chefs, and culinary personalities who entertained and educated approximately 60,000 passionate gourmands and aficionados during this star-studded, four-day destination event. This year's Festival raised more than $2 million for the Chaplin School of Hospitality & Tourism Management and Southern Wine & Spirits Beverage Management Center at Florida International University.

Nicole Parker Will Now Host LA Drama Critics Circle's 45th Annual Awards Ceremony

The Los Angeles Drama Critics Circle has announced that Nicole Parker, nominee for Lead Performance in Funny Girl, will host its 45th Annual Awards ceremony (replacing the previously announced James Roday). Joining performers Constance Jewell Lopez (nominee for Lead Performance in Dreamgirls), Beth Malone, and Lowe Taylor will be Shannon Warne and Kim Huber. Gordon Clapp and Richard Schiff will also perform an excerpt from the LA Theatre Works production of Glengarry Glen Ross.

38 Special Cancels SeaWorld Concert Amidst Blackfish Controversy

38 Special has followed Martina McBride, Willie Nelson, REO Speedwagon, Trisha Yearwood, Barenaked Ladies, Cheap Trick, and Heart in cancelling their upcoming performance at SeaWorld amidst intense public pressure fueled by the popular documentary film Blackfish.

REO Speedwagon Becomes Sixth Group to Cancel SeaWorld Concert

REO Speedwagon has followed Trisha Yearwood, Cheap Trick, Heart, Barenaked Ladies, and Willie Nelson in cancelling its upcoming performance at SeaWorld following intense public pressure fuelled by the popular documentary film Blackfish. After more than 2,500 people signed a Change.org petition, the American rock band has cancelled its previously scheduled concert at SeaWorld in Orlando, Florida.
